The Theragun G3 was my first Theragun and I was a believer after my first use. The Mini now gives me the ability to easily travel with my Theragun and have relief anytime. I like to mountain bike and my ambitions of how far I can go in my mind, are further than my body and muscles want to! I had an experience with muscle cramping from riding to far on a hot day, the mini would have been a lifesaver If I had it at the time. The Mini comes with a nice travel pouch, one attachment and works with all the attachments from my G3. The Mini, just like my G3 feels very well made. The mini has 3 speed settings and low is perfect for doing your neck. The G3 only has 2 speeds and even the lowest speed could be a little to hard for some people when doing sensitive areas. The Mini is considerably quieter than my G3, but still has the power to loosen you up. The Theragun Mini gives you piece of mind that no matter where you are or what you’re doing, you always have muscle or back pain relief at your reach!

    I asked to receive this product because I have a full size massage gun of another brand that I use at home and it really pounds the muscles really nicely and can reach my back when I lay down on the bed, so I wanted to try a smaller version to take with me to work. So, when I received the Theragun Mini, it was in a nice boxed package. It was inside the carrying case and the charger that plugs into the wall and the instruction booklet were underneath. My first impression for a “mini” was that the box was heavy. Once I picked up the unit, I still thought this was heavy for a travel mini edition, but was willing to give it a try during the week going to work. I work in a lab hunched over a computer and on a lab bench day after day, so the side muscles on my neck, my trapezius muscles from my neck to my shoulders, and then going down each side of my back on each side of my spine hurts every day. Because of social distancing, I have not been able to give myself the TLC I need, like a massage, or a chiropractic adjustment, or go to physical therapy, so I thought that this might help relieve some of the tightness that builds up during the day. The unit is compact and much smaller than a regular sized unit, and it is somewhat lighter, but I don’t think that it is light enough. Holding it for anything more than 5 minutes up near your shoulder and neck and your arms are tired. To turn on the unit, there is a button on one side and you hold it down until the unit starts on the first speed as indicated by the first light. To go to the second and third speed, you press the button down once for each speed. The power of the unit is wonderful, the first speed is my favorite, the second and third are just fast and faster. In my opinion, for a travel mini, I think they could have saved some money and weight of the unit if they just offered a satisfying one speed. At all three speeds, the unit is not noisy at all and you can have a conversation with someone while using it. Probably cannot have a phone conference because it would come through as interference, but a conversation at normal speaking volume would be no problem at all. To shut the unit off, press the same button on the side and hold it until the unit stops moving and all the lights go off. When using it at the office, I did find it difficult to reach parts of my back with the unit having limited reach, so that was a drawback. Too bad there was not a telescoping recessed hide-away handle that would allow a further reach. That would have been awesome. The other thing that that I noticed when taking it to work and back is that there was no place in the carrying case to stow the charger. Where do you put that when traveling? It would have been nice to put it in the same carrying case, like a pocket on the outside, but at least they put their brand name on the charging unit, so when in a bag full of other chargers, at least you can identify it. Overall, a strong, useful, quiet, small, unit that will help anyone that has muscle pain and can’t or don’t have time for a massage to provide muscle relief. Really nice and I am glad I asked for it.
